Pen Llystyn 59-60 Bryncir, Lleyn Peninsula


Site code:
1228


Site details:
Location: Pen Llystyn 59-60, Bryncir, Lleyn Peninsula, 1968, Gwynedd, Wales SH481449
Period: roman 1st-5th C AD
Category: fort
Notes: carb. grain from two postholes nr middle of NE granery
Topography: flat topped hill of glacial gravel
Condition: dry
Report type: charcoal/wood

Bibliography
Seddon B. 1968. Charcoal. 190. In: Hogg A H A. Pen Llystyn: A Roman fort and other remains. Archaeol. J. 125. 101-92. Wales, Gwynedd
